Hachimycin Properties: Yellow crystals. Acid reaction. Forms a water-sol sodium salt. Can be pptd as a water-insol salt by acridine derivs such as acriflavine, by sulfa drugs such as homosulfanilamide, by basic antibiotics such as streptomycin base, by enzymes such as papain and lysozyme, by dyes such as methylene blue, and by metallic salts such as CaCl2. LD50 i.p. in mice: 0.05 mg/10-12 g mouse (Hosoya). hamycin Properties: Yellow amorphous powder, no definite mp, decomp 160¡ã. [a]D25+216¡ã. uv max (80% methanol): 383 nm (E1%1cm 916). An amphoteric compd. Almost insol in water, benzene, chloroform, dry lower aliphatic alcohols, ether. Sol in basic solvents such as pyridine, collidine, and in aq lower alcohols. In concd H2SO4 gives stable blue color; no coloration with ferric chloride or with HCl. LD50 i.v. in mice (using sodium carboxymethyl cellulose as a vehicle): 6.16 mg/kg (Williams). Also reported as LD50 i.v. in Swiss mice (using a colloidal suspension): 1.20 mg/kg (Parekh, Dave). |
